Solve the following equation by using the addition principle. Check the solution. \( 13=\mathrm{a}-7.1 \) The solution is \( a=\square \). (Type an integer or a decimal.)

Solution

We start with the equation:   13 = a - 7.1 To isolate a using the addition principle, add 7.1 to both sides:   13 + 7.1 = a - 7.1 + 7.1 This simplifies to:   20.1 = a So, a = 20.1. Checking the solution by substituting a back into the original equation:   20.1 - 7.1 = 13   13 = 13 Since both sides match, our solution is correct.
